Siding installation services involve attaching new exterior coverings to a property’s walls, enhancing both the appearance and durability of the building. This process typically includes removing old or damaged siding,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the chosen siding material to ensure a secure fit. Homeowners may opt for siding installation when building a new home, updating an outdated exterior, or repairing sections that have suffered weather-related damage. Skilled contractors focus on providing a seamless finish that improves the overall look of the property while offering added protection against the elements.
Many property owners turn to siding installation to address common problems such as cracking, warping, or rotting of existing siding materials.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ations can cause siding to deteriorate, leading to increased energy costs and potential structural issues. Installing new siding can help prevent water infiltration, reduce drafts, and improve insulation. Additionally, siding upgrades can significantly boost curb appeal, making a home more attractive and potentially increasing its value.

The overview below groups typical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Bend,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many minor siding repairs in North Bend, WA, typically range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ve patching or replacing small sections and are usually on the lower end of the cost spectrum. Fewer jobs fall into the higher price range for minor fixes.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of siding or upgrading specific areas gener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, depending on material choices and the size of the area.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ding overhauls for homes in North Bend often fall between $5,000 and $15,000.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range, especially with premium materials or intricate designs.
Custom or High-End Installations - High-end siding installations using premium materials or custom designs can reach $20,000 or more. While these are less common, they represent the upper tier of typical costs for extensive or luxurious siding proj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of siding materials can local contractors install? Local siding installation experts typically work with a variety of materials including v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al to suit different home styles and preferences.
How do I know if my home needs siding replacement or repair? A professional siding contractor can assess the condition of existing siding to determine wh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ended based on damage or wear.
What are common signs that siding needs maintenance or replacement? Signs include warping, cracking, mold or mildew growth, and significant fading or peeling paint, which may indicate the need for service from a local siding specialist.
